If you open up Windows Live on your PocketPC and tap 'Menu' then 'Account Options' and then 'Switch Account' it will give you a warning about how you can't sync your e-mail. Tap 'Yes' and it will remove the account from the unit. From there sign up the _exact same_ account again, and login. Your contacts will be online as they should be normally. This will persist through Log Off

The only caveat to this process, is when you soft-reset your phone ... you will experience the same problem as before and will have to repeat the same process I just described above. So far it's the only work around I have been able to find.
